In een voortdurend evoluerende professionele wereld, waar data een overheersende rol spelen, zijn data engineers essentiële spelers geworden. Gespreksvragen voor data engineers zijn daarom cruciaal voor zowel kandidaten als recruiters. .een pionier op het gebied van werving op basis van potentieel, erkent het belang van deze professionals en biedt innovatieve oplossingen voor het identificeren van talent op dit gebied. Dit artikel leidt je door de essentiële vragen die je kunt tegenkomen tijdens een sollicitatiegesprek voor een functie als data engineer, zodat je je beter kunt voorbereiden en je vaardigheden beter voor de dag kunnen komen.

De rol en verantwoordelijkheden van een data engineer begrijpen

Definitie en hoofdtaken

Een data engineer is een professionele gespecialiseerde professional in het ontwerp, de implementatie en het onderhoud van datamanagementsystemen en -infrastructuren. Hun rol is essentieel om bedrijven in staat te stellen hun gegevensbronnen effectief te benutten. In een interview met een data engineer is het van vitaal belang dat je laat zien dat je deze rol goed begrijpt.

De belangrijkste taken van een data engineer zijn :

  1. Ontwerp en implementatie van datapijplijnen
  2. Optimalisatie van extractie-, transformatie- en laadprocessen (ETL)
  3. Beheer en onderhoud van databases
  4. Datakwaliteit en -beveiliging garanderen

Belangrijke technische vaardigheden om in deze functie uit te blinken

Om als data engineer te slagen, is het essentieel om een aantal set van technische vaardigheden verschillende. Verwacht tijdens je gesprek met een data engineer dat je gevraagd wordt naar je kennis op de volgende gebieden:

  • Programmeertalen: Python, Java, Scala
  • SQL en NoSQL databases
  • Big data tools: Hadoop, Spark, Hive
  • Systemen voor het beheer van gegevensstromen: Kafka, Flink
  • DevOps-methodologieën en containerisatietools

Het verschil tussen een data engineer en een data scientist

Het is belangrijk om het onderscheid tussen deze twee vaak verwarrende rollen te begrijpen. Een data engineer richt zich op opzetten en onderhouden van de gegevensinfrastructuurEen datawetenschapper richt zich op het analyseren en interpreteren van gegevens om inzichten te verkrijgen. Tijdens je sollicitatiegesprek kan je worden gevraagd dit verschil uit te leggen en te laten zien hoe deze twee rollen samenwerken.

Werkgelegenheidssectoren

Er is in veel sectoren vraag naar data-engineers. Hier is een overzicht van de belangrijkste werkgebieden:

Sector Percentage van werkgelegenheid
Financiën 25%
Technologie 30%
Gezondheid 15%
E-commerce 20%
Andere 10%

Bereid je antwoorden op veelgestelde vragen voor

Wat is data-engineering en waarom is het cruciaal voor bedrijven?

Data engineering is het proces van het ontwerpen ontwerp en bouw van systemen die het mogelijk maken om op grote schaal gegevens te verzamelen, op te slaan en te analyseren. Tijdens je gesprek met een data engineer moet je kunnen uitleggen hoe deze discipline bedrijven in staat stelt om beslissingen te nemen op basis van betrouwbare en toegankelijke gegevens.

Wat is jouw ervaring met Hadoop en het ecosysteem voor grote gegevens?

Hadoop is een essentieel open-source framework voor gedistribueerde verwerking van grote datasets. Bereid je tijdens je sollicitatiegesprek voor op je ervaring met Hadoop en de onderdelen ervan, zoals HDFS (Hadoop Distributed File System) en MapReduce. Leg uit hoe je deze tools hebt gebruikt om echte big data problemen op te lossen.

Wat zijn je vaardigheden op het gebied van programmeren en gegevensmodellering?

Programmeervaardigheden zijn fundamentele voor een data engineer. Wees voorbereid om je beheersing van talen als Python, SQL en misschien Scala of Java te bespreken. Als het gaat om datamodellering, moet je de verschillende benaderingen kunnen uitleggen (bijv. relationeel vs. NoSQL-model) en wanneer je ze moet gebruiken.

Hoe beheer je grote, ongestructureerde datasets?

Het beheren van enorme, ongestructureerde gegevens is een grote uitdaging op het gebied van Big Data. Tijdens je gesprek met een data engineer kan je gevraagd worden naar je aanpak om met dit soort gegevens om te gaan. Bespreek de technieken en tools die je gebruikt, zoals gedistribueerde verwerking, datastreaming of het gebruik van NoSQL-databases.

Beheersing van technische en organisatorische aspecten

Gegevensinfrastructuur: Hadoop, HDFS en andere tools

De gegevensinfrastructuur is de basis het werk van een data engineer. Tijdens je sollicitatiegesprek moet je in detail kunnen uitleggen hoe Hadoop en het gedistribueerde bestandssysteem (HDFS) werken. Wees voorbereid om andere tools in het big data ecosysteem te bespreken, zoals Spark, Hive of HBase, en hoe ze passen in een algemene data-architectuur.

Gegevens en pijplijnen beveiligen

Gegevensbeveiliging is een grote zorg voor alle bedrijven. Als data engineer moet je kunnen aantonen dat je verstand hebt van best practices in gegevensbeveiliging. Cela inclut la gestion des accès, le chiffrement des données, la conformité aux réglementations (comme le RGPD), et la mise en place de systèmes de surveillance et d’alerte.

ETL-processen optimaliseren voor betere prestaties

Het optimaliseren van ETL-processen (Extract, Transform, Load) is essentieel om de efficiëntie van datapijplijnen te garanderen. Wees tijdens je interview met een data engineer voorbereid op het bespreken van de technieken die je gebruikt om de prestaties te verbeteren, zoals parallellismede cachingofquery optimalisatie. Donnez des exemples concrets de situations où vous avez réussi à optimiser un processus ETL et les résultats obtenus.

Specifieke interviewvragen beantwoorden

Hoe heb je in het verleden een big data-oplossing ingezet in een project?

Deze vraag is bedoeld om je praktische ervaring met het implementeren van big data-oplossingen te beoordelen. Geef een gedetailleerd voorbeeld van een project waarbij je een dergelijke oplossing hebt geïmplementeerd. Leg uit wat de ondervonden uitdagingenuitdagingen technologische gemaakt en de bereikte resultaten. N’oubliez pas de mentionner comment cette solution a apporté de la valeur à l’entreprise.

Leg een technische uitdaging uit die je hebt overwonnen in data engineering

Recruiters willen graag weten of je in staat bent om complexe problemen op te lossen. Geef een specifiek voorbeeld van een technische uitdaging die je bent tegengekomen in je werk als data engineer. Beschrijf het probleem, je aanpak om het op te lossen en de geleerde lessen in het proces. Laat zien hoe je je technische vaardigheden en creativiteit hebt gebruikt om het obstakel te overwinnen.

Hoe werk je samen met cross-functionele teams om datakwaliteit te garanderen?

Samenwerking is een cruciaal aspect van het werk van een data engineer. Wees tijdens je sollicitatiegesprek voorbereid op het bespreken van je ervaring met het samenwerken met verschillende teams, zoals datawetenschappers, bedrijfsanalisten of ontwikkelaars. Leg uit hoe je effectief communiceert met deze teams, hoe je verwachtingen en prioriteiten beheert en hoe je ervoor zorgt dat de geleverde gegevens aan ieders behoeften voldoen.

Stel relevante vragen tijdens het gesprek

Vragen over de tools en technologieën die het bedrijf gebruikt

Toon je interesse en proactiviteit door vragen te stellen over detechnologische omgeving van het bedrijf. Hier zijn enkele voorbeelden van vragen die je zou kunnen stellen:

  • Wat zijn de belangrijkste tools en technologieën die worden gebruikt in uw datastack?
  • Hoe beheer je de schaalbaarheid van je data-infrastructuur?
  • Hebt u plannen om uw gegevensarchitectuur te moderniseren?

Vragen over de huidige gegevensinfrastructuur en toekomstige plannen

Laat je langetermijnvisie zien door meer te weten te komen over toekomstige toekomstige projecten gegevensbeheer. Hier zijn enkele relevante vragen:

  • Wat zijn de belangrijkste uitdagingen op het gebied van gegevens waarmee het bedrijf momenteel wordt geconfronteerd?
  • Zijn er plannen om in de nabije toekomst nieuwe technologieën of methodologieën toe te passen?
  • Hoe ziet u de rol van de data engineer in uw organisatie evolueren?

Laat zien dat je geïnteresseerd bent in de ontwikkeling van datatechnologieën binnen het bedrijf

Laat tot slot zien dat je passie hebt voor continu leren en dat je geïnteresseerd bent ininnovatie in het gegevensveld. Je kunt vragen stellen als:

  • Hoe blijft het bedrijf op de hoogte van de nieuwste ontwikkelingen op het gebied van datatechnologieën?
  • Zijn er mogelijkheden voor trainingen of conferenties voor data engineers?
  • Hoe ziet het bedrijf het gebruik van opkomende technologieën zoals machine learning of kunstmatige intelligentie in zijn gegevensprocessen?

Een succesvol data engineer interview vereist een grondige voorbereiding en een duidelijk begrip van je rol als data engineer, dus wees voorbereid om niet alleen je kennis te laten zien, maar ook je aanpassingsvermogen en passie voor het steeds veranderende gebied van data.